What Are Cataracts?
If you have actually ever wondered what creates cloudy vision as you age, the solution might extremely well be cataracts. Cataracts are an usual eye condition that affects the quality of the lens inside your eye. The lens is typically clear, allowing light to go through and focus on the retina. Nevertheless, as you age, proteins in the lens can glob with each other, causing cloudiness and obstructing the passage of light. This cloudiness leads to fuzzy vision, problem seeing during the night, sensitivity to light, and discolored shades. With time, cataracts can substantially impact your vision, making day-to-day tasks challenging.
Cataracts can create in one or both eyes and usually development slowly.
While aging is the primary cause of cataracts, other aspects such as cigarette smoking, diabetes mellitus, too much sun direct exposure, and specific drugs can likewise boost your risk.
Thankfully, cataracts can be treated effectively with surgery to change the cloudy lens with a clear synthetic lens, restoring your vision and enhancing your quality of life.
Reasons and Danger Elements
As you delve into the causes and threat aspects related to cataracts, it becomes clear that while aging is the main instigator, other elements can likewise contribute in their advancement. Exposure to ultraviolet radiation from the sun, cigarette smoking, and particular clinical problems like diabetes can raise your danger of creating cataracts. Genes additionally play a considerable function, as cataracts can run in families. Injuries to the eye, the long term use corticosteroid medicines, and also extreme alcohol intake have been linked to cataract formation.
Furthermore, existing wellness conditions such as weight problems and high blood pressure can add to the growth of cataracts. It's important to take care of these problems to lower your danger.
Furthermore, way of life variables like poor nourishment and an absence of anti-oxidants in your diet regimen can potentially intensify cataract formation. Treatment Options
Checking out treatment choices for cataracts unveils a variety of effective treatments that can help enhance your vision and lifestyle. In the beginning of cataracts, upgrading your eyeglass prescription or making use of brighter lights may assist handle signs and symptoms. Nonetheless, as the cataracts progress and start to hinder day-to-day tasks, surgical treatment ends up being the key treatment option.
Cataract surgical procedure entails getting rid of the cloudy lens and changing it with a clear fabricated intraocular lens. This procedure is secure, fast, and extremely successful, with many clients experiencing boosted vision soon after surgical treatment.
There are various kinds of intraocular lenses offered, including multifocal lenses that can remedy both near and distance vision, minimizing the demand for glasses post-surgery. Your eye doctor will certainly help you select one of the most ideal lens based upon your way of living and aesthetic requirements.
